(adjective) : Sacrŏvir, i, m. Julius Sacrovir * A nobleman of the Hoedui in Gaul, Tac. A. 3, 40; 3, 44 al.—Hence, Sacrŏvĭrĭānus, a, um, , of or named from Sacrovir: bellum,Tac. A. 4, 18.
Charlton T. Lewis, Charles Short, A Latin Dictionary
